
This hybrid School Psychologist role supports students within general and special education settings by delivering comprehensive psychological services to families, teachers, and administrators. Key responsibilities include conducting initial and three-year evaluations for special education eligibility, drafting detailed assessment and behavior intervention reports, and collaborating with ARD committees to develop instructional strategies. The position also involves participating in manifestation determination reviews and assisting with IEP implementation.
